Guest UserWe knew the service would be good as soon as we booked, and within hours we received a welcome email, listing the ways we could contact them if we needed to.
On the pick up at the airport, they were speedy and efficient and the taxi ride only took us 20 minutes with traffic.
As we walked through the door we were blown away by the interior decoration, only then to find that hotel had been a former palace!
Historic artifacts and pictures were strewn through the hallways and the outside only matched the royal feel with perfection.
We stayed in the royal suite, with a big bed and balcony. The staff were great, the breakfast was standard for off peak times and although the location isn't in the depth of Thamel, the area most will go out for eating and drinking, it was within 30 minutes drive of most landmarks and as it was the ambassedy/ office worker area, there was a nice vibe.
There were some things that can't be controlled. The hotel did a good job of providing heat as the weather in February is still chilly.
The pollution was real. Especially as you walk nearer the streets, something to think about if you are sensitive to this. Apart from that, It was all really wonderful. Niraj Yadav the receptionist and the team, we thank you dearly.

Our stay at Gokarna was underwhelming. We had selected it based on their website that included a description of biking but when we arrived, there was no organized biking activities. The rooms were fine but a bit overpriced (although the beds were very comfortable). The food was unremarkable and expensive by local standards. Breakfast was not even set up when we went at 7AM. The pool was on the cold side and then charged 1800 rupees extra to use the sad little jacuzzi in the change room. There was a very noisy wedding on site the night we were there that kept us up. It can be challenging to get a taxi to the location. The golf course is beautiful though.

The hotel service is very professional, the breakfast is rich, and the front desk service is warm and thoughtful. When I asked for water, it was delivered quickly. There is also a hair dryer in the hotel, and the hot water for bathing is very comfortable.
Many Chinese people go to other places to find Chinese food, but they find that the most authentic Chinese food is on the ninth floor above the hotel. And the chocolate brownie here is very authentic. It was supposed to be eaten with ice cream, but I asked for hot ice cream, and the hotel immediately made hot ice cream. There is the largest farmer's market in Kathmandu next to the hotel, and 6 big apples cost less than 20 yuan. You can buy all kinds of vegetables and fruits here.
Because Kathmandu is often congested, if you connect with a flight, the hotel is very close to the airport, which is another big advantage.
